Mica is naturally occurring non-toxic silicate mineral that has been used for centuries in cosmetic products, as insulation material in electric cables, and as a filler in cement and asphalt. Though the workers belonging to the cosmetic manufacturing industry are at high risk of mica exposure through inhalation. A large amount of mined mica boasts green or blue hues and therefore, iron oxides and other additives are added to give it different colors. Heat treatment is also often used to boost the metallic appearance of cosmetic mica powder. When the mica mineral is crushed to form a powder, it displays a glowing luster that makes it a favorable ingredient to mix with the cosmetic products. Due to its reflective color application, it is the most common natural and chemical ingredient that is widely used in lipsticks, foundations, blusher, and eye shadow. The massive range of bold pigmented and long-lasting shades makes it an appropriate choice to blend and create colorful cosmetic products. Apart from being used in makeup products, it is also used in several other industries including art and crafts such as painting, pen turning, soap making, embossing, scrapbooking, and sculpture making.

Cosmetic mica powder is considered primarily dangerous only when inhaled because the particles can get into the lungs and can cause pneumoconiosis that increases the risk of lung and breathing related problems.
